JavaScript学习笔记(第一部分)总共四部分1 JavaScriptJavaScript主要负责前端界面中的行为。它是一门运行在浏览器端的脚本语言。一开始主要是用于处理网页中的前端验证,如:用户名长度,密码长度等。js的特点:解释型语言、类似于C的语法结构、动态语言、基于面向对象。1.1 基本的输出语句主要学习三个关键字:alert、document、console.<script&g
转载
2023-09-20 13:56:09
74阅读
文章目录1.JavaScript的概述2.JavaScript的组成3.JavaScript的基本数据类型和复杂数据类型4.JavaScript是弱数据类型的语言5.JavaScript中的作用域与变量声明提升?6.介绍 JavaScript 的原型,原型链?有什么特点?以及闭包的相关知识7.JavaScript如何实现继承?8.数组去重的方法9.ajax请求数据的方法 1.JavaScript
转载
2023-10-07 22:40:15
268阅读
# JavaScript 考试系统
## 引言
JavaScript 是一种广泛应用于 Web 开发的编程语言,它具有灵活性和易用性,几乎可以在任何浏览器中运行。随着互联网的普及,越来越多的在线教育平台和在线考试系统都使用 JavaScript 进行开发。本文将介绍如何使用 JavaScript 构建一个简单的考试系统,并提供相应的代码示例。
## 考试系统需求分析
考试系统通常需要具备以
原创
2023-08-08 13:10:02
184阅读
1、题目描述
找出元素 item 在给定数组 arr 中的位置
输出描述: 如果数组中存在 item,则返回元素在数组中的位置,否则返回 -1 输入例子: indexOf([ 1, 2, 3, 4 ], 3) 输出例子: 2 代码: function indexOf(arr, item) {
var index=-1;
for(var i=0;i&
# 登录页面 ```html 登录页面 登录页面 注册 忘记密码 © 2023 MrFlySand ``` ```html 首页 首页:
原创
2023-06-18 12:19:04
51阅读
1. 变量提升原题如下:+ function() {
alert(a);
a();
var a = function() {
console.log(1);
}
function a() {
console.log(2);
}
alert(a);
a();
var c = d = a;
}()
alert(d);
a
JS基础(一)(1)、数据类型1、js数据类型: 8种js基础类型:5种js引用类型:3种2、null、undefined、isNaN,NaNnull是一个表示"无"的对象,转为数值时为0;undefined是一个表示"无"的原始值,转为数值时为NaN。**3、如何判断数据类型?typeof/instanceOf/Object.prototype.toString**检测数组的方法:Object
转载
2023-10-07 12:28:34
89阅读
将字符串abc-def-ghi转换为驼峰格式这里我们的思路是利用字符串方法和正则表达式const str = 'abc-def-ghi';
const camelCaseStr = str.replace(/[-_][^-_]/g, match => match.charAt(1).toUpperCase());
console.log(camelCaseStr); // 'ab
转载
2024-06-26 20:26:59
32阅读
# JavaScript网页考试系统
JavaScript是一种用于网页开发的编程语言,它可以为网页增加交互性和动态性。在本文中,我们将介绍如何使用JavaScript构建一个简单的网页考试系统。
## 系统概述
我们的网页考试系统由以下几个部分组成:
1. 问题和选项:系统需要显示一系列问题,并提供多个选项供用户选择。
2. 计分逻辑:系统需要根据用户选择的答案计算得分,并显示最终结果。
3.
原创
2023-08-08 13:08:53
293阅读
# JavaScript上机考试实现指南
## 1. 流程图
```flow
st=>start: 开始
op1=>operation: 准备考试题目
op2=>operation: 开发考试页面
op3=>operation: 实现考试计时器
op4=>operation: 验证考试答案
op5=>operation: 计算得分
op6=>operation: 显示结果
e=>end: 结束
原创
2023-08-08 11:11:55
120阅读
javascript编程题 JavaScript has a pretty diverse set of developers. One of the biggest reasons is that JavaScript supports multiple programming paradigms. JavaScript can be written imperatively, you can
转载
2024-07-27 11:45:58
30阅读
本文是锻炼编程逻辑思维的一些题的归纳,红色字体是个人认为初学比较难懂的题。1.日期计算器:用户输入年月日,计算并打印出来是今年的第几天,星期几 1 function data(){
2 //首先输入年月日
3 //1900年 1月1日为周一
4 var year =Number(prompt("
转载
2024-01-03 13:42:06
56阅读
目录一、JavaScript简介1.1 JavaScript介绍1.2 为什么学习 JavaScript1.3 JavaScript与ECMAScript的关系1.4 JavaScript版本 二、JavaScript语句、标识符、变量2.1 语句2.2 标识符2.3 JavaScript保留关键字2.4 变量2.4.1 变量提升二、JavaScript引入到文件2
转载
2023-10-07 12:34:25
67阅读
1.什么是javascript? 在浏览器端执行一种编程语言。javascript和java没有任何关系 ,只是语法和java相同。也有一些差异。2.javascript作用? a.前端验证 b.操作html c.ajax核心技术之一 d.获取浏览器的一些相关信息
原创
2021-07-09 10:08:31
158阅读
1.什么是javascript? 在浏览器端执行一种编程语言。javascript和java没有任何关系 ,只是语法和java相同。也有一些差异。 2.javascript作用? a.前端验证 b.操作html c.ajax核心技术之一 d.3....
原创
2022-04-13 09:42:43
137阅读
JavaScript 作为一种脚本语言身份的存在,因此被很多人认为是简单易学的。然而情况恰恰相反,JavaScript 支持函数式编程、闭包、基于原型的继承等高级功能。由于其运行期绑定的特性,JavaScript 中的 this 含义要丰富得多,它可以是全局对象、当前对象或者任意对象,这完全取决于函数的调用方式。JavaScript 中函数的调用有以下几种方式:作为对象方法调用,作为函数调用,
转载
2023-10-08 10:43:37
60阅读
JavaScript的用处什么是JavaScript语言JavaScript可以干什么 什么是JavaScript语言JavaScript 是脚本语言JavaScript 是一种轻量级的编程语言。JavaScript 是可插入 HTML 页面的编程代码。JavaScript 插入 HTML 页面后,可由所有的现代浏览器执行。JavaScript 很容易学习。JavaScript可以干什么1、Ja
转载
2023-06-06 16:39:13
103阅读
一、概述1.JavaScript是世界上最流行的脚本语言。 2.JavaScript与java内容上没有多大的联系。 3.JavaScript对后端十分重要。 4学习JavaScript框架——vue(虚拟DOS 和模块化设计结合) 5.JavaScript只花了10天左右就开发出来了。二、快速入门1.基本语法JavaScript和css差不多。 2.浏览器控制台使用 console.log(XX
转载
2023-06-08 18:57:28
124阅读
JavaScript是一种基于文本的跨平台、解释型和面向对象的语言。JavaScript用于客户端和用户端开发,也以开发网页而闻名。它用于吸引用户,因为它允许交互式网页。JavaScript有一个对象库,如数组、数学和日期,还有一组语言元素,如运算符、语句、控制结构。 使JavaScript如此受欢迎的6大用途: Web应用程序: 这是JavaScript的惊人用途之一。现代浏览器不断改
转载
2023-08-14 20:17:12
96阅读
Web设计和开发是现今越来越流行的职业方向之一。工欲善其事,必先利其器,如果你想在这个领域出类拔萃,那么你就必须具备一些优秀的技能,例如能操作不同的平台、IDE和其他各种各样的工具。谈到平台和IDE,现在已经不是以前那个掌握一个IDE就能“一招鲜吃遍天”的时代了。激烈的竞争以及蔓延到现在的集成开发环境。基于IDE是用于创建和部署应用程序的强大客户端应用程序,下面我们要分享的就是对于很多网页设计师和
转载
2024-08-22 13:33:29
11阅读